Variable Benefits That Make Familiar Game Loops Feel...

Repeatedly playing through familiar game loops can lead to burnout if the experience becomes overly predictable. To maintain excitement over long periods, game developers often introduce variable benefits that alter how rewards are distributed during core gameplay tasks. By blending unexpected outcomes with established mechanics, creators ensure that even routine actions yield surprising and engaging results for players.

The Dynamic Appeal of Variable Incentives

Static reward structures frequently cause players to lose interest once they understand the fastest route to progression. Introducing fluctuating perks and randomized drops breaks up repetitive cycles, creating heightened anticipation prior to completing familiar tasks. This psychological mechanism turns routine grind into an evolving journey of exploration.

When outcomes are not strictly guaranteed, players pay closer attention to every interaction. This dynamic environment encourages gamers to experiment with alternative approaches rather than relying on a single dominant strategy. Over time, the subtle variety keeps the underlying loop feeling responsive and continuously engaging.

Reinvigorating Core Mechanics Through Surprise

Surprise elements breathe new life into fundamental mechanics without requiring a complete overhaul of the game code. Small adjustments, such as altered drop rates or temporary stat boosts, can transform ordinary encounters into memorable events. Players remain motivated knowing that any standard objective might yield exceptional results.

Balancing Equity and Unpredictability

While variable rewards add necessary excitement, game designers must carefully manage overall fairness to preserve trust. Excessive randomness can frustrate players if they feel their skill or invested time no longer impacts their success. Implementing baseline guarantees alongside chance mechanics helps strike an ideal balance.

A well-balanced system ensures that persistent effort is consistently honored while still offering occasional unexpected highlights. This hybrid approach protects the integrity of competitive play while preserving the thrill of discovery. Gamers enjoy the excitement of unpredictable bonuses without experiencing feeling cheated by luck.

Bridge Strategies For Balancing Safety And Opportunity

Finding the right equilibrium between conservative play and tactical risk is a fundamental skill in contract bridge. Players must constantly weigh the security of a safe contract against the higher rewards of aggressive bidding and play. Mastering this delicate balance allows partnerships to protect their points while capitalizing on vulnerable opponents.

Evaluating Hand Potential vs Environmental Risk

Accurate hand valuation extends far beyond basic high-card points when deciding to push for ambitious contracts. Strategic players analyze suit distribution, honor concentration, and seating position before making a decisive move. Taking calculated chances becomes much safer when you have clear suit fit and favorable table position.

Conversely, overestimating weak holdings under unfavorable vulnerability can lead to severe penalties. Assessing environmental factors ensures that every aggressive bid is backed by real mathematical odds rather than mere speculation. Understanding these subtle dynamics prevents unnecessary losses during crucial tournament rounds.

Managing Risk During Bidding Auctions

Competitive bidding sequences often force partnerships to make rapid decisions under intense pressure. Maintaining disciplined communication prevents misread signals and keeps auctions within manageable safety thresholds. Players should establish clear agreements to signal when a hand is suited for cautious defense rather than offensive expansion.

When opportunities arise, measured aggression can disrupt the opposing side's communication and steal valuable bidding space. Executing Safety Plays in Declarer Play

Once the contract is set, declarers face choices between guaranteed tricks and risky finesses for extra points. A safety play deliberately sacrifices a potential overtrick to eliminate the chance of failing the contract entirely. Implementing these protective techniques safeguards your team against bad suit breaks across opposing hands.

However, when extra tricks are vital to winning a match, declarers must recognize when taking a finesse is necessary. Weighing the probability of adverse distributions helps you decide whether to protect the base contract or chase maximum score potential. This analytical approach separates steady players from top-tier competitors.

Adapting Defensive Strategies to Table Dynamics

Defenders must also balance caution and opportunity when selecting initial leads and defensive returns. Playing passive leads protects against giving away free tricks to the declarer's hidden hand. In contrast, active defense becomes imperative when time is running out to defeat a tight contract.

Recognizing the exact moment to shift from safe passive plays to bold attacking leads requires sharp observation. Partner signaling and auction clues guide defenders toward the most effective line of play. Consistent practice and post-game analysis refine these instincts over time.
